Common spring home issues & how to prevent them

Stay ahead of common seasonal issues
Spring is a time for fresh starts, but as the seasons change, your home may face some unexpected issues. From lingering winter damage to new maintenance challenges, it’s important to stay ahead of common problems to keep your home in top shape. Here are some of the most frequent spring home issues - and how to prevent them.
1. Boiler & heating system struggles
After working hard through winter, your boiler and heating system may start to show signs of wear. Leaks, strange noises, or reduced efficiency can signal an issue.
Prevention tips:
- Bleed your radiators to ensure even heat distribution.
- Check for leaks around your boiler and radiators.
- Schedule a professional boiler service to catch any problems early.
2. Damp & mould growth
As temperatures rise, condensation and damp spots can turn into mould problems, particularly in poorly ventilated areas like bathrooms and kitchens.
Prevention tips:
- Open windows regularly to improve airflow.
- Use a dehumidifier in problem areas.
- Check for leaks under sinks and around windows and doors.
3. Roof & gutter damage
Winter storms and heavy rainfall can take a toll on your roof and gutters, leading to leaks and blockages that could cause water damage.
Prevention tips:
- Inspect your roof for missing or damaged tiles.
- Clear leaves and debris from gutters to prevent water overflow.
- Look for signs of water stains or damp patches on ceilings.
4. Pests finding their way inside
As the weather warms up, insects and rodents become more active and may seek shelter in your home.
Prevention tips:
- Seal any gaps around doors, windows, and pipes.
- Keep food stored in airtight containers to avoid attracting pests.
- Check for nests or droppings in attics, garages, and under sinks.
5. Outdoor appliance & equipment wear and tear
If you’re getting ready to use your lawnmower, barbecue, or outdoor furniture, you may notice they’ve suffered over the winter months.
Prevention tips:
- Clean and service outdoor appliances before using them.
- Check for rust or wear on garden tools and furniture.
- Store seasonal items in a dry, sheltered place when not in use.
